School Bus Mini BOok

I would have to say one of my favorite projects to make is the mini book. I've made quite a few of them and I am on the Design Team for the Cricut Mini Albums blog. This week's theme was "Back To School".

I create this book using my Gypsy and the bus shape is from Doodlecharms. I welded a narrow rectangle to the left side of the bus shape to give it a straight edge for binding the book.



Each page is designated for grades PreSchool through 8th grade.

I used pockets as photo mats, so school information for that grade can be documented.




Many of the corners were made using border punches (there is a tutorial earlier on my blog)
